INDIANAPOLIS – Indianapolis freshman Paige Giovenco and Rockhurst senior Ashton Vinton have respectively been named the Great Lakes Valley Conference/Athletic Solutions Player of the Week in women's and men’s golf, it was announced by the league office Thursday.
WOMEN’S PLAYER OF THE WEEK
Paige Giovenco, Indianapolis
Fr. | Sellersburg, Ind.
Major: Sport Management
Team Results: 6th/9 Teams (298-309-300–907) at Folds of Honor (9/15-17)
- Placed runner-up in 52-golfer field
- Carded scores of 69-73-71 for total score of 213 (E)
- Led the tournament in par-3 scoring average (2.75) and birdies (14)
- Earns first career Player of the Week Award

MEN’S PLAYER OF THE WEEK
Ashton Vinton, Rockhurst
Sr. | Springfield, Mo.
Major: Business
Team Results: 1st/19 Teams (278-295-291–864) at Midwest/Central Regional Preview (9/15-16)
- Finished third in 106-golfer field
- Carded scores of 69-72-73 for total score of 214 (+1)
- Placed second in par-3 scoring average (3.00) and tied for fifth in par-4 average (4.07) and birdies (9)
- Earns first career Player of the Week Award
